Job Description

 

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Lead the strategic placement of highly complex, multi-layered, or specialized commercial accounts, including those requiring bespoke solutions or alternative risk transfer mechanisms.
  • Cultivate and maintain senior-level relationships with underwriters and key decisionmakers at both standard and specialty carriers, including excess and surplus (E&S) markets.
  • Design and execute tailored market strategies that align with client risk profiles and business objectives.
  • Serve as a trusted advisor to Producers and Client Executives, contributing to new business development and client retention through placement excellence.
  • Provide strategic guidance on the use of captives, fronting arrangements, programs, and other alternative risk financing strategies.
  • Support the negotiation of manuscript forms and complex endorsements in coordination with legal and compliance teams.
  • Act as a thought leader within the broking community, helping to shape internal placement standards, tools, and protocols.
  • Mentor junior brokers and assist with training, development, and knowledge transfer across the team.
  • Collaborate with the SVP of Broking Strategy to elevate carrier engagement, broking innovation, and strategic partnerships.

Qualifications

Education & Experience

  • Minimum of 7 years of experience in insurance broking, underwriting, or risk placement, with a strong focus on large, complex, or specialized accounts.
  • Demonstrated expertise in negotiating with both admitted and non-admitted carriers, including experience with specialty lines or industry-specific markets.
  • Strong understanding of alternative risk solutions, including captives, risk retention groups, and structured programs.
  • Proven ability to influence client strategy and deliver innovative insurance placement outcomes.
  • Exceptional market knowledge, relationship-building, and communication skills.
  • Experience mentoring or leading junior broking staff preferred.
  • Commercial Lines Broker License.
